logo

Output 18354153ca7b14f9566f02a33f322bcadf334762b14a95da0bf3529a384ff0a9:1

value
1339455
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38da0a558be52b86bbceba60ec6f22e994aa4ca4 OP_EQUALVERIFY OP_CHECKSIG
address
16Bc3TGQ3qpKKnUvGw6W3QPWofXGHrQhBu
transaction
18354153ca7b14f9566f02a33f322bcadf334762b14a95da0bf3529a384ff0a9